From blindly thinking that human beings are all kind; to discovering the horror of war, finding that killing Ludendorff does not prevent war because of human nature, so she agrees that "humanity is not worth saving"; to being Steve Such people are moved by the quality of fighting to the end at the cost of their lives. From the frog at the bottom of the well, to knowing the existence of ugliness, to knowing more and discovering that good and evil coexist, this is growth. There is only one kind of heroism in the world, and that is to love it after knowing the truth of life. Just arrived in London, Steve told her the truth, she did not understand; Patrick Morgan (Aris) disguised as an approachable, she believed it. I would rather believe in false beauty than accept true ugliness. The director introduced Wonder Woman into the society, and portrayed the image of ignorance and sophistication too delicately.
